First of all, very good trash can. Convenient with the foot pedal to open it. Color and design as specified. What you simply must not forget is that you attach the white soft rubber nubs bottom side, otherwise he would slip there very easily always.
Use it personally for the diapers in the baby room, must say with the 35liter fee bag he seals very good odors.
Only drawback in my opinion - the attachment of the bags is quite easy to bend (you should be careful with handle).

A normal 35-litre rubbish bag from Switzerland can be put over the bucket just but easily.
When it is full and you want to push the rubbish down, the whole rubbish bag goes with it. My tip. Put a plastic band in the bin as a resistance, then it's super!
